Output fda760853f653ae85e2d2834a765f3cf484364708194025b04982503fa0394c6:0

value
2036039
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2393da940bc209dba9306b8cb1e041dffef1fff2 OP_EQUAL
address
34w8hKbZYjpLsCCgsrrcdw7uduuQ22TX3M
transaction
fda760853f653ae85e2d2834a765f3cf484364708194025b04982503fa0394c6
spent
true